sometimes results don't transfer to lightroom

I'm using Lightroom Classic CC on a Mac Pro
I export photos to Helicon Focus from within Lightroom, Helicon Focus opens, click render, photos are stacked, click save, name the file, get a warning to exit Helicon Focus, which I do, and Lightroom reappears.
But sometimes the stacked photo does not appear in Lightroom's grid. It DOES show in Mac's Finder. If I try to import the new file from within Lightroom it is grayed out (like it's already been imported).
Exiting/reopening Lightroom is ineffective. Change view from grid to loupe -same
Eventually the file will show up - because I've done something? Don't know.
I suspect this is a Lightroom issue but am hoping the problem has been discussed here (I had no luck w/a search).
